Detail of evening gown
Detail of back of evening gown to show where capelet can be attached. Off-white lurex velvet evening gown; worn with capelet (Object ID #1981.107.B) to form two piece evening ensemble. Performance gown worn by Hildegarde. -
Dress
Dark red silk dress; A-line; finely pleated ruffling around neckline, center front placket, sleeves, and skirt hem; long sleeves; five square crystal buttons on placket; hand-picked zipper closure; knee length. From Hildegarde's personal wardrobe. -
Dress
Black wool double knit dress; A-line skirt hangs from yoke/sleeve piece; center front slit with one covered button closure; knee length. Worn with hat (Object ID #1982.309). Wor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ening cape
Aqua silk peau de soie cape; lined in silk broadcloth; floor length. Worn with evening gown (Object ID #1981.23). Performance ensemble wor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ening coat
Celadon green double silk ribbed twill evening coat; inset "V" at back neck; Ruana shape: square open in front, sides sewn together to knees, open to ankles; longer in back than front. Worn by Hildegarde as a performance coat. -
Evening coat
Cranberry red heavy fulled wool flannel swing evening coat; all-over rhinestones applied with rivets; standing collar; set-in sleeves widen at elbow; inseam pockets on modified princess line; cranberry red silk lining; most rhinestone have lost their red paint. Wor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ening coat
Black chenille long evening coat; solid black sequins and cross bars of black chenille; architecturally structured with straight front and long straight strips of chenille between sequins; wide back and sides of angled strips of chenille; strips of cellophane embedded beneath sequins to create glimmer effect. Custom made for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Green silk chiffon evening gown; long trailing cape sleeves; attached long scarf forms high neckline and trails down back; shoulder yoke points to deep V in front; five layers of different shades of green; back zipper closure; crepe underdress; label is missing; floor length. Custom made as a performance gown for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Charcoal gray silk kimono-style evening gown; red and orange shapes running vertically from armscye to bottom of skirt (likely a batik process); 3/4 length sleeves with turned-back cuffs; slits at lower edge of skirt; attached scarf flows from neckline; long skirt.
Label: Hudré - Hotel Orrington, Evanston, IL. -
Evening gown
Navy silk chiffon evening gown; large red flowers, tie-dye or batiked fabric; very full sleeves; straight skirt; attached scarf at neckline that flows down back; underdress of navy crepe with beige yoke. Wor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Black chiffon evening gown; sweetheart neckline; lace bodice with pink underneath; padded puff sleeves; padded bustline; full skirt; side zipper closure; stiff along hemline; crepe underskirt is weighted. Purchased 2/29/1940. Worn by Hildegarde. This gown was custom-made for Hildegarde at Bergdorf-Goodman -
Evening gown
Ivory satin evening gown; design of cut velvet flowers; sleeveless; mandarin collar. Performance evening gown wor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Mustard yellow silk crepe evening gown; V-neckline; sleeveless; shoulder pads; draping in front; mustard yellow brocade ribbon criss-crosses in front; long. Wor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
A. Mauve silk charmeuse evening gown; trimmed in burgundy silk velvet at neckline and armscyes; plunging neckline at front and back; sleeveless; bias cut; mermaid silhouette; unlined; ankle length. B. Burgundy velvet belt; lined with mauve silk charmeuse; ties at side.
According to Sister Aloyse Hessburg, this gown is a copy of the bronze gown by Chauvel (2012.01.51.AB). This gown is attributed to "Cafe de Paris in London by Ilene Adair." -
Evening gown
Off-white silk matelasse evening gown; princess style; blue beaded trim at neck and sleeve edges; floor length. Worn with evening cape (Object ID #1981.22). Performance ensemble wor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Black lace evening gown; lace over black chiffon and beige crepe; flowing lace sleeves; attached chiffon neck scarf. Wor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Silver lamé evening gown; plunging V-neckline; heavily padded shoulders; batwing sleeves, zippers at wrists; three open-ended darts at bustline; empire waistline with red beaded lace over cream netting, same trim on lower sleeves; center back zipper closure; inverted box pleat from waistline down; skirt slit below knee; rounded off hemline; front skirt has short overskirt with rounded edge; back skirt has godet at center back for flare, forming a train. Performance gown worn by Hildegarde. -
Evening gown
Black silk crepe evening gown; strapless; six white narrow vertical strips applied evenly along gown with white bows at top; strips run down dress below knee, flaring out with six godets; black sequin beading runs completely around white strips; corselet bodice understructure, back hook closures; center back zipper with hook and eye closures. Worn by Hildegarde for the first time in Milwaukee in 1948. -
Evening gown
Off-white crepe and chiffon evening gown; plunging neckline; orange, turquoise, and silver beading along neckline and straps, coming to bow at front; smocking at shoulder straps and midriff; padded bust-line; low back with beaded braid following around; back zipper closure; skirt flares from right below midriff, gathered at bow; full skirt, lined in satin-back crepe. Worn with slip. Purchased in 1942. Worn by Hildegarde.
